engler@csl.Stanford.EDU said:
> I wrote an extension to gcc that does global analysis to determine
> which pointers in 2.4.1 are ever treated as user space pointers (i.e,
> passed to copy_*_user, verify_area, etc) and then makes sure they are
> always treated that way.
Nice work - thanks. One request though, to you and anyone else doing such
cleanups - please could you list the affected files separately near the
beginning of your mail, so that people can tell at a glance whether there's
anything in there that might be their fault.
